The Nigerian Air Force (NAF) has officially kicked off the specialized warfare training of its personnel in Kaduna, in collaboration with the British Military Assistance Training Team (BMATT). The six-week BMATT training programme for selected NAF personnel is aimed at developing the capacity of the personnel to train others for Force Protection in a complex environment. The training is a continuation of the NAF’s efforts at strengthening its Base Defence system to be able to respond to a wide range of situations that might threaten NAF Bases across the country. It would be recalled that the NAF only recently held a Base Defence Retreat and commissioned an electronic shooting range as well as the newly built Regiment Training Centre in Kaduna, in preparation for the commencement of the BMATT organized training.
